]> git.proxmox.com Git - mirror_qemu.git/blobdiff - hw/virtio-blk.c
block: convert qemu_aio_flush() calls to bdrv_drain_all()
[mirror_qemu.git] / hw / virtio-blk.c
index d6d1f87cda6348414b55d9fe5fe8266a37b07acf..4b0d113ba89541b38e2a9a6006124da3e0b43abd 100644 (file)
@@ -474,7 +474,7 @@ static void virtio_blk_reset(VirtIODevice *vdev)
      * This should cancel pending requests, but can't do nicely until there
      * are per-device request lists.
      */
-    qemu_aio_flush();
+    bdrv_drain_all();
 }
 
 /* coalesce internal state, copy to pci i/o region 0